The NI USB 6009 is a low-cost, multifunction data acquisition (DAQ) device from National Instruments (NI) widely used for basic measurement and control applications. The datasheet is indispensable for selecting the right sensors and actuators to interface with the NI USB 6009. For instance, understanding the analog input voltage range allows you to choose sensors that output signals within that range, avoiding saturation or damage. Similarly, the digital I/O specifications guide you in connecting compatible digital devices. It’s also essential for troubleshooting. If your measurements are not what you expect, the datasheet can help you identify potential issues related to signal levels, sampling rates, or input impedance. A basic comparison between two common specifications in the NI USB-6009 is given below.

Specification Value
Analog Input Range ±10 V
Maximum Sampling Rate 48 kS/s
